January 24, 20233 yr 7 minutes ago, Teryne said: I was told to use the AGM setting but i need to change other settings asi have solar panels and all Solar panels does not affect the battery settings. You can however still choose between the 3 modes of charging in 16. I use solar charging only and prefer running in bypass if I see the battery getting low at bed time. I control bypass with a remote switch to switch AC input on or off. Normally when LS is during the night say after 22h I use bypass set to start after running on battery during the LS period. Start is 10min after estimated power on again.

Has anyone got some settings for this please Email is available You have it set to run in bypass when there is no solar and you have also set it to charge from grid when no solar. These are 2 different settings. You can set it to only charge from solar then it will not charge anything when battery is discharged but switch to grid. Also look at your setting for priority. Change that from utility to SBU.
